San Francisco City Hall

Historic San Francisco City Hall supporting the City’s offices and courtrooms was built in 1912 and is an existing steel frame with masonry infill structure. Following the Loma Prieta earthquake in 1989, the building was severely damaged.

TME's Engineering services included seismic damage survey and development of upgrade solutions which included damage assessment; analysis of the buildings existing lateral capacity; peer review of non-structural elements; preliminary design through Construction Documents and Construction Administration for seismic upgrade of the dome and drum. Steel bracing added at dome base was thoughtfully detailed for ease of construction.

PRIME - Forell Esesser Engineers in Association with OLMM Structural Design and Tennebaum-Manheim Engineers.
Owner: City of San Francisco
